Output 95e252b603f39319d39ec3149b6fa56d8a42e70e5d30ca03eabd7ef57d774d2a:0

value
9841163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f041c77e958329ac3a2070de1ab286fa772f9da3 OP_EQUAL
address
3PbNu1NZNHqTfwnb1sJiNPGTRCxkGpSTsB
transaction
95e252b603f39319d39ec3149b6fa56d8a42e70e5d30ca03eabd7ef57d774d2a
confirmations
175361
spent
true